Discussion - Charts

Review

We often see charts (graphs) and tables in everyday newspapers and magazines that attempt to communicate information.

Respond and Discuss

Respond and discuss to the following task:

  • Select a graph or table from a recent article that communicates biased information based on the presentation of the chart or table.
  • Identify and explain the specific weaknesses.
  • Describe how you might correct the weaknesses and create a better (more objective) display of the data.
  • Identify one biblical passage on why we need to be vigilant in all that we do in communicating statistical results.
  • Discuss the role and use of data in light of biblical and/or ethical principles; for instance, discuss how we should avoid presenting data for our own benefit.

Initial posts to the discussion topic should be in the range of 150-300 words; replies to the posts of other learners providing additional constructive insights should be in the range of 100-200 words.
